Output d3e447119fd045b293f3bf2896c6a9d6721d55cf7b98acbc0cb29b7f62ecb4b2:1

value
27941470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884f7b81b24d9ff0aa00489fab123a21648afaf2 OP_EQUAL
address
3E7m3Ap4PfNA27HX47pa7e5SKyqaD4AGJV
transaction
d3e447119fd045b293f3bf2896c6a9d6721d55cf7b98acbc0cb29b7f62ecb4b2
confirmations
104024
spent
true